h2o.mojo_predict_df

H2O Prediction from R without having H2O running


Description

Provides the method h2o.mojo_predict_df with which you can predict a MOJO model from R.

Usage

h2o.mojo_predict_df(
  frame,
  mojo_zip_path,
  genmodel_jar_path = NULL,
  classpath = NULL,
  java_options = NULL,
  verbose = F,
  setInvNumNA = F
)

Arguments

frame

data.frame to score.

mojo_zip_path

Path to MOJO zip downloaded from H2O.

genmodel_jar_path

Optional, path to genmodel jar file. If NULL (default) then the h2o-genmodel.jar in the same folder as the MOJO zip will be used.

classpath

Optional, specifies custom user defined classpath which will be used when scoring. If NULL (default) then the default classpath for this MOJO model will be used.

java_options

Optional, custom user defined options for Java. By default '-Xmx4g -XX:ReservedCodeCacheSize=256m' is used.

verbose

Optional, if TRUE, then additional debug information will be printed. FALSE by default.

setInvNumNA

Optional, if TRUE, then then for an string that cannot be parsed into a number an N/A value will be produced, if false the command will fail. FALSE by default.

Value

Returns a data.frame containing computed predictions
